Dolly Parton is celebrating love—and wine—this Valentine’s Day by launching her very own signature Pinot Noir under the Dolly Wines label. Coincidentally released in the same month as her iconic song Jolene fifty-one years ago, the hand-crafted California Pinot Noir is perfect for romantic Valentine’s Day dinners or festive Galentine’s Day gatherings.

Taking to social media (@dollywines), Parton encouraged fans to raise a glass and toast her new “shooting star,” Pinot Noir. The vibrant, ruby-red wine marks Dolly Wines’ fourth release globally and second in the U.S.

The wine’s silky texture and fresh palate, enriched with notes of red fruit and hints of vanilla, deliver a joyful experience in every sip. With aromas of sweet cherries, oven-fresh blueberry pie, and subtle dried thyme, the Pinot Noir earned an impressive 92-point rating from renowned wine critic James Suckling.

Where to Find Dolly’s Pinot Noir

Available now in-store and online at leading retailers including Kroger, Total Wine & More, Publix, and Cost Plus World Market, this premium wine is priced accessibly at a suggested retail price of $14.99 USD.

The launch of this red varietal follows the success of Dolly Wines’ U.S. debut Chardonnay, which received a stellar 93-point rating from Wine Enthusiast. Known for its notes of white peach, sweet cream, and toasty oak, it made a splash with wine enthusiasts and collectors alike.

About Dolly Parton and Accolade Wines

Dolly Parton, a living legend of country music and philanthropy, continues to expand her creative empire. Her illustrious career spans seven decades and includes 26 #1 Billboard country hits, multiple chart-topping albums, and countless accolades. Recently in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ame, Dolly continues to captivate fans worldwide with her creativity, philanthropy, and innovation.

Accolade Wines, a global leader in wine production with over 35 million cases sold annually, partnered with Parton Family Cellars to bring Dolly Wines to market. Offering Pinot Noir, Chardonnay, Rosé, and Prosecco, the collaboration invites wine lovers and fans alike to sip and savor Dolly’s world.
